FLUFFY BELGIAN WAFFLES



Fluffy Belgian Waffles image

The perfect amount of batter for 3 fluffy waffles in my Belgian waffle maker.

Provided by LadyBeedough

Categories     World Cuisine Recipes     European     Belgian

Time 15m

Yield 3

Number Of Ingredients 9

nonstick cooking spray
2 large eggs
1 cup milk
¼ cup vegetable oil
1 tablespoon white sugar
¼ teaspoon salt
3 teaspoons baking powder
½ cup all-purpose flour
½ cup whole wheat flour

Steps:

  • Spray a Belgian waffle iron with cooking spray and preheat according to manufacturer's instructions.
  • Beat eggs with a whisk until fluffy. Beating slightly after each ingredient, first add milk, then oil, sugar, salt, baking powder, all-purpose flour, and finally whole wheat flour; do not overbeat.
  • Pour 3/4 cup batter into the center of the hot waffle iron, spreading with a metal knife if necessary. Close the iron and bake until it stops steaming, 2 to 5 minutes, depending on your iron. Carefully remove cooked waffle with a fork and repeat with remaining batter.

CLASSIC BELGIAN WAFFLES



Classic Belgian Waffles image

Provided by Food Network

Time 13m

Yield 8 to 10 (4 by 4-inch) waffles

Number Of Ingredients 9

2 cups cake flour
2 teaspoons baking powder
1/2 teaspoon salt
4 large eggs, separated
2 tablespoons sugar
1/2 teaspoon vanilla extract
4 tablespoons unsalted butter, melted
2 cups milk
non-stick cooking spray

Steps:

  • Preheat the waffle iron according to the manufacturer's instructions. In 1 medium bowl sift together flour, baking powder, and salt. Set aside. In a second bowl use the wooden spoon to beat together the egg yolks and sugar until sugar is completely dissolved and eggs have turned a pale yellow. Add the vanilla extract, melted butter, and milk to the eggs and whisk to combine. Combine the egg-milk mixture with the flour mixture and whisk just until blended. Do not over mix. In third bowl, beat the egg whites with an electric mixer until soft peaks form, about 1 minute. Using the rubber spatula, gently fold the egg whites into the waffle batter. Do not overmix! Coat the waffle iron with non-stick cooking spray and pour enough batter in iron to just cover waffle grid. Close and cook as per manufacturer's instructions until golden brown, about 2 to 3 minutes. Serve immediately.

BELGIAN WAFFLES



Belgian waffles image

Serve up a treat for breakfast time (or dessert) with easy homemade Belgian waffles. Top with whatever you fancy - fruit, ice cream, and bacon are all classics

Provided by Sophie Godwin - Cookery writer

Categories     Breakfast, Brunch, Dessert

Time 15m

Number Of Ingredients 11

240ml buttermilk
60g unsalted butter , melted
½ tsp vanilla extract
1 large egg
240g plain flour
½ tsp salt
1 tbsp caster sugar
½ tsp baking powder
¼ tsp bicarbonate of soda
oil , for greasing
berries , Greek yogurt and a drizzle of honey, streaky bacon and maple syrup, ice cream and chocolate sauce, peanut butter and banana

Steps:

  • Whisk the buttermilk, melted butter and vanilla together in a large bowl. Separate the egg and whisk the yolk into the buttermilk mixture. Whisk the egg white in a clean bowl until it forms stiff peaks - this will keep your waffles light and fluffy.
  • Weigh all the other dry ingredients into a bowl. Whisk in the wet ingredients to create a smooth batter then carefully but decisively fold through the egg white - don't worry if you are left with a few small lumps. Cover with cling film and leave the batter to sit for 30 mins, if you have time.
  • Lightly oil then heat your waffle maker (or see the tip below). Heat the oven to low, so you can keep each waffle warm while the next one cooks. Pour enough batter for one waffle (about a quarter) into the waffle maker, close the lid and cook until the waffle is golden brown on both sides and will come away from the maker easily, about 2 mins. Repeat with the remaining batter, then top with whatever you fancy.

CLASSIC FLUFFY BELGIAN WAFFLES - FOOD NEWS
Belgian waffles are yeasted waffles made in waffle irons with big, deep pockets. The recipe has evolved over the years and many newer ones call for baking powder as the leavener, which also makes them quicker to make. But true Belgian waffles rely on yeast and some rising time to give the waffles a more complex flavor and an airier lift.
